From 99ac521841d6445b7133dfa6013ff12a7ea702b1 Mon Sep 17 00:00:00 2001 From: Matthew Flatt Date: Thu, 4 Jun 2009 13:41:48 +0000 Subject: [PATCH] section char, Latex macro that can be redefined to disable color svn: r15076 --- collects/scribble/latex-render.ss | 1 + collects/scribble/scribble.tex | 6 ++++-- 2 files changed, 5 insertions(+), 2 deletions(-) diff --git a/collects/scribble/latex-render.ss b/collects/scribble/latex-render.ss index c77925e760..714787b1b4 100644 --- a/collects/scribble/latex-render.ss +++ b/collects/scribble/latex-render.ss @@ -618,6 +618,7 @@ [(#\☻) "$\\blacksmiley$"] [(#\☹) "$\\frownie$"] [(#\à) "\\`{a}"] + [(#\uA7) "\\S"] [else c]) c)]))) (loop (add1 i))))))) diff --git a/collects/scribble/scribble.tex b/collects/scribble/scribble.tex index 43cba6848e..6edf199116 100644 --- a/collects/scribble/scribble.tex +++ b/collects/scribble/scribble.tex @@ -11,7 +11,9 @@ \usepackage[usenames,dvipsnames]{color} \hypersetup{bookmarks=true,bookmarksopen=true,bookmarksnumbered=true} -\newcommand{\inColor}[2]{{\Scribtexttt{\color{#1}{#2}}}} +\newcommand{\SColorize}[2]{\color{#1}{#2}} + +\newcommand{\inColor}[2]{{\Scribtexttt{\SColorize{#1}{#2}}}} \definecolor{CommentColor}{rgb}{0.76,0.45,0.12} \definecolor{ParenColor}{rgb}{0.52,0.24,0.14} \definecolor{IdentifierColor}{rgb}{0.15,0.15,0.50} @@ -23,7 +25,7 @@ \newcommand{\Scribtexttt}[1]{{\texttt{#1}}} \newcommand{\schemeplain}[1]{\inColor{black}{#1}} -\newcommand{\schemekeyword}[1]{{\color{black}{\Scribtexttt{\textbf{#1}}}}} +\newcommand{\schemekeyword}[1]{{\SColorize{black}{\Scribtexttt{\textbf{#1}}}}} \newcommand{\schemesyntaxlink}[1]{\schemekeyword{#1}} \newcommand{\schemecomment}[1]{\inColor{CommentColor}{#1}} \newcommand{\schemeparen}[1]{\inColor{ParenColor}{#1}}